The Shepherds Rest - UK455321 bedroom, Sleeps 2.

Lovely shepherds hut with decked area - perfect for a romantic break for two to explore this wonderful area. All on the ground floor.
Open plan living space.
Living area:
With wood burner and Smart TV.
Dining area.
Kitchen area:
With electric cooker, microwave, slow cooker and fridge.
Bedroom: With double bed.
Shower room: With shower cubicle and toilet.

Electric central heating, electricity, bed linen, towels and Wi-Fi included. Welcome pack. Rear garden with sitting-out area, garden furniture and barbecue. Private parking for 1 car. No smoking.
